GET A LOAD OF THIS NEW SONG BY CONTRADASH

Internet creative Contradash(@contradash) has been on what I can only describe as an “extended album roll out,” as he gears up for the release of “Bandolier,” his forthcoming full length project that’s been in the works for quite some time now. Contradash himself has been pretty vocal on his instagram stories, as well as live streams where he discusses the project’s status, potential tracks on the project, and even what the cover art might look like. For the past few months we’ve received a stream of album related as well as unrelated tracks that might be a sort of filler for the sort of in-between moments we’re currently in. Anyway, late last month Contradash gave us his latest single “Get a load of this guy,” a track that plays into Dash’s alt-rock focused sound rather than the “digi-core” style that made him most popular, but it's not at all a bad thing. 


“Get a load of this guy” sounds like an early 2010s alt rock song with a pop driver edge, and of course we get Contradash’s deep autotune washed tone that helps set his music apart as usual. Going into this track I was expecting a self-destructive vibe since Dash decided to put himself under the scope in the cover art for this song, but rather we hear him be more bitter and slightly vindictive on this one. As is common in his music, Contradash dedicates this song’s theme to a past lover who from the sound of it, he isn’t on the best of terms with. Contradash of course rips into this person, her character, and even her new relationship, but interestingly, despite the jabs he throws their way, he reveals himself as simply Jealous. Lines like “He's so cool from his coat to his jeans, like I wish that I was him, I wish I could be yours,” show us that Dash often plays it cool, but inside is mostly hurting.
